How to make a grass cutter from a washing machineUsing a grass cutter in gardening makes it possible to effectively get rid of grass. If you put finely chopped grass in a compost pit, then in a short time you will get excellent plant food. It is not always possible to purchase a shredder, so a DIY grass cutter made from a washing machine is an excellent alternative.

Features of work

The chopper works on the principle of a food processor. The device consists of several elements:

  • two containers for cutting and collecting grass;
  • motor and connecting wiring;
  • steel frame and cover;
  • shaft with knives.
To move the grass cutter comfortably, it can be equipped with wheels. The shaft receives rotational motion from an electric motor, and the grass, taking into account the movement of the device, enters the cutting tank. The chopped plants go into a container for collection.

Assembly steps

DIY grass cutter from a washing machine

The motor shaft needs to be drilled with an electric drill. The size of the two holes made must be approximately 1 cm. A pre-made bushing is placed on the shaft. Sleeve length – no less 60 mm. A thread is cut at one end and holes are made at the other.

This element is best made in a lathe. Then the holes made on the shaft and bushing are connected, where bolts are installed for fastening.The motor is directly fixed to the bottom of the grass cutter tank with pins. The tank can be cut to height, taking into account the ease of use of the machine.

Attention: At this stage of production, the motor only needs to be baited to determine the location of the outlet on the wall of the container. After the hole is ready, the electric motor is completely secured.

The knives are installed on the sleeve and then secured with nuts. It is necessary to secure the knives so that the operation of the grass cutter is not interrupted due to impacts against the walls of the container. At the bottom of the tank, you need to make a hole with a grinder to remove the crushed mass. The size of the hole is chosen based on personal preference, but it must be below the level of the knives.

Afterwards, a casing is made from a steel plate near the hole to prevent the grass from being scattered when the grass cutter is operating. Using welding, a frame is made from the corners where the tank is placed.

The prepared container with the attached motor is firmly fixed to the frame by welding. Next you need to connect the electric motor. To do this you need to use a tester. This will allow you to find out the output of the working and starting windings. It is necessary to compare the resistance of the two windings - the working winding has a lower resistance.

The connection is made in this way: the cable from the start key is connected to one end of the starting winding, the other end is connected to the wire and the working winding. The end of the working winding that remains is connected to the start key wire.

Preparation for production

Preparation is determined by the choice of electric motor, as well as grass cutting knives. The design of the knives causes different final effects. The circular blade makes it possible to grind grass and thin twigs. This is the best option for use on a personal plot. The wood saw is suitable for creating diamond-shaped knives.

Electric motor power is the main factor to consider when choosing a motor. Low-power electric motors are only suitable for cutting grass.

Important: Electric motors with a power of approx. 1.6 kW can easily chop branches with a diameter of up to 1.5 cm. This motor is well suited for making grass cutters.

Security measures

The grass cutter has sharp blades that rotate at high speed. Therefore, it is necessary to use glasses as eye protection.

If foreign objects get into the working part of the knives, this can not only damage the device, but also cause injuries when solid pieces fly out.

The operation of the grass cutter is also dependent on the power supply, so you need to be careful and follow all safety measures: keep children away from the grass cutter, monitor the operation of the electric motor, and the integrity of the wiring cable.

Motor selection

On new washing machines, electric motors are controlled by complex controllers and microcircuits, so installing them in the design of a grass cutter does not make sense. It is advisable to choose old washing machines. Eg, washing machine "Fairy" And "Oka" are a great option.

Washing machine "Oka" It is made in the form of a barrel, equipped with a metal drum, the laundry is placed on top, the motor is located at the bottom. This design, with minor modernization, makes it possible to make a chopper.

Engine power - 200 W, number of revolutions 1360-1430 rpm. For a regular grass cutter that works for no more than half an hour, this motor is quite enough.

IN "Fairy" washing mashines a centrifuge is installed for spinning, so the engine has a higher number of revolutions - 2750-2900 rpm. Moreover, it is less powerful. Since the machine body itself is plastic, it is best to use only a motor to make a grass cutter.

Types of grass cutters

The installed motor determines the type of device. There are several types: gasoline or electric grass cutter. The gasoline unit is characterized by increased power and does not depend on electricity, this determines its mobility.

The electrical device is compact and light in weight, but less powerful. If the volume of mown grass is insignificant, equipment suitable for 1.6 kW. For long-term use and when chopping large branches, it is better to choose a motor 5 kW.
